Transaction 25418c72c226a58145ca6f33b19906b3e169fc623962249569ed61c11d211dfc

1 Input
2 Outputs
  • 25418c72c226a58145ca6f33b19906b3e169fc623962249569ed61c11d211dfc:0
  • value  476892968
    address  14XzTqZ8aXS8fhRCi1PYr47KjXMVJqLh7A
  • 25418c72c226a58145ca6f33b19906b3e169fc623962249569ed61c11d211dfc:1
  • value  11618974
    address  16i47m7UTEp98rhywJTryuXtarToBtMarG